š¤ How to Create a Student Account
Log in to your TTRS Admin Dashboard
Click on āUsersā in the top menu
Select āAdd Student manuallyā
Enter the learnerās name, and add an email address (optional)
Click āSaveā ā the learner is now ready to log in from their device
ā± Practice Recommendations
Aim for 2ā3 modules per session, 3ā4 times per week
Each module takes about 5ā10 minutes
A full session might be 10ā30 minutes, depending on your learnerās stamina
Encourage repeating complex modules for mastery
Keep early sessions short and positive

š» Device & App Setup
Browser access
Use Google Chrome or Firefox for the best experience
Log in via: us.ttrsonline.com (US & Canada) or eu.ttrsonline.com (All other regions)
iPad App:
Download the free TTRS app from the App Store
Use learner credentials to log in
For best results, pair the iPad with a keyboard
Phones/Tablets:
Parents can use the Reporting App to track progress on iOS and Android
š§° Key Tools: Unlocking Modules & Free Writing
Unlocking Modules:
Go to the Admin Dashboard
Select the studentās name
Click āUnlock Modulesā to give access to more levels
Free Writing Tool:
Learners access Free Writing from their menu
They can type paragraphs or full stories
The tool gives feedback on:
Number of correctly spelt words
Typing speed (if enabled)
Admins can view and comment on submitted work
āļø Free Writing helps bridge the gap between copying and composing written work independently.
